As I watched Inbee Park accept her flowers and hugs and accolades at the KPMG Women’s Championship last year I hoped I wasn’t watching the end of her career.  I really admire Park’s game. She’s patient, balanced, persistent, and precise – a champion in every respect. So I’m delighted to see her back in the field and bringing that delicate melding of technical skill and mental strength playing golf at a high level requires. I’m thinking she wouldn’t be putting herself in into competition if she wasn’t fully healthy. If that’s the case, we’ll see Inbee Park on the front page of the board.
